Tip #4 – Combining Rsi Divergence With The Double Top And Double Bottom
Double top, also referred to as double bottom, is a reversed pattern that is formed following an extended move or following the direction of a trend. Double tops are formed when prices reach an unbreakable level. The price will then retrace some distance, only to return to the prior level. A DOUBLE TOP happens where the price bounces off this mark. Below is a double top. It is evident in the double top that both tops were created following a powerful move. It is evident that the second top has not been able to break the top of the previous. This is a clear indication that a reverse is on the way as it suggests that buyers are having difficulty going higher. The same set of principals apply to the double bottom, but oppositely.
